How to Maintain a Robot Cleaner
A robot cleaner is an appliance that cleans or mops the floor automatically. It is typically powered by batteries and has sensors to avoid furniture and walls. Self-emptying dustbin
Self-emptying dustbins allow you to run your robot cleaner on a regular basis without having to worry about the accumulation of debris. This will keep your floors clean and reduce the amount allergens in air. It is important to be aware that the process of emptying the bin can be loud. The base collects the dust from vacuuming until it is full and then releases it into a larger container. The sound can last up to a full minute and be louder than your vacuum. Some models have the DND (do not disturb) mode that you can use to make the process quieter.

The majority of robot cleaners are outfitted with sensors that allow them to navigate around obstacles. For instance, some models come with LiDAR-based navigation systems which use laser scanners to map the surroundings. This technology allows the robot to avoid bumping into furniture, ensuring that all areas are maintained efficiently. Other models have camera-based navigation systems that use built-in optical cameras to create a visual map. These systems may not be able recognize objects in dim lighting. Finally, there are robots with cameras and LiDAR-based navigation systems.

While robots don't require regular maintenance, it's a good idea for you to check your brushes regularly for hairs that are tangled and empty the dustbin (and rinse it out if necessary) on a regular schedule. Additionally, you should wipe the cameras and sensors on your robot to make sure they are clear of dust and dirt prior to each cleaning session. If you own a robot that mops, it's also recommended to wash the pads regularly and allow them to dry before using them again.
